| public class GuardEliminationCornerCasesTest extends GraalCompilerTest { |
| |
| static class A { |
| |
| } |
| |
| static class B extends A { |
| |
| } |
| |
| static class C extends B { |
| |
| } |
| |
| static class D extends C { |
| |
| } |
| |
| @SuppressWarnings({"static-method", "unused"}) |
| private int testMethod(Object a) { |
| if (a instanceof A) { |
| if (a instanceof C) { |
| if (a instanceof B) { |
| B b = (B) a; |
| if (b instanceof C) { |
| return 1; |
| } else { |
| GraalDirectives.deoptimizeAndInvalidate(); |
| } |
| } |
| } else { |
| GraalDirectives.deoptimizeAndInvalidate(); |
| } |
| } |
| return 0; |
| } |
| |
| @Test |
| public void testFloatingGuards() { |
| HighTierContext context = getDefaultHighTierContext(); |
| StructuredGraph graph = parseEager("testMethod", AllowAssumptions.YES); |
| new ConvertDeoptimizeToGuardPhase().apply(graph, context); |
| CanonicalizerPhase canonicalizer = new CanonicalizerPhase(); |
| new LoweringPhase(canonicalizer, LoweringTool.StandardLoweringStage.HIGH_TIER).apply(graph, context); |
| Debug.dump(Debug.BASIC_LOG_LEVEL, graph, "after parsing"); |
| |
| GuardNode myGuardNode = null; |
| for (Node n : graph.getNodes()) { |
| if (n instanceof GuardNode) { |
| GuardNode guardNode = (GuardNode) n; |
| LogicNode condition = guardNode.getCondition(); |
| if (condition instanceof InstanceOfNode) { |
| InstanceOfNode instanceOfNode = (InstanceOfNode) condition; |
| if (instanceOfNode.getValue() instanceof ValueProxy) { |
| myGuardNode = guardNode; |
| break; |
| } |
| } |
| } |
| } |
| |
| AbstractBeginNode myBegin = (AbstractBeginNode) myGuardNode.getAnchor(); |
| AbstractBeginNode prevBegin = BeginNode.prevBegin((FixedNode) myBegin.predecessor()); |
| myGuardNode.setAnchor(prevBegin); |
| |
| Debug.dump(Debug.BASIC_LOG_LEVEL, graph, "after manual modification"); |
| graph.reverseUsageOrder(); |
| new DominatorConditionalEliminationPhase(true).apply(graph, context); |
| new SchedulePhase(SchedulePhase.SchedulingStrategy.EARLIEST).apply(graph); |
| } |
| } |
